These fees can significantly increase the cost of the loan, making it important ... WebJun 17, 2024 · If the fees do change, the lender must pay the difference. 10% tolerance. If the total amount of fees disclosed in this category are more than 10% of the initial quote, the lender must pay the difference above 10%. WebAug 31, 2024 · Mortgage origination fees are generally 0.5% to 1% of the value of the loan. For instance, a $400,000 home loan could have a fee ranging from $2,000 to $4,000 fees.
